Hi Ed,
I think oScrBar:Thumbpos will never become zero as per it's logic. It'sminumum value is always 1.
It's true that it will never return zero, but if you pass zero to it (using 'oScrBar:thumbPos := 0'), the internal var ::lOverride will be set .T. nevertheless (and .F. if any non-zero values were passed). Brgds, Viktor _______________________________________________ Harbour mailing list Harbour@harbour-project.org http://lists.harbour-project.org/mailman/listinfo/harbour